Protecting the digestive mucosa and improving transit
Peppermint helps to reduce acid production in the stomach and stimulate mucin production. It is therefore the perfect complement to measures taken to reduce the appearance of gastric ulcers. It relaxes smooth muscles and stimulates digestive processes, helping to ease difficult transit and combat intestinal spasms.
Supporting the athletic horse
Tonic, relaxing, neuroprotective and antioxidant, mint is the ally of the athletic horse. Using it will boost your horse's morale and long-term resistance.
Stimulating immunity
The immune response to pathogens already known to the body is naturally stimulated. Certain substances in peppermint have been studied for their effects on certain microbes (viruses, fungi, bacteria).
Combating excess iron
Peppermint 'captures' iron from the food it is ingested with and helps to eliminate it, working in favour of vitamins B9, C and E, manganese, calcium, copper, magnesium and potassium. Excess iron plays a role in metabolic problems, laminitis, liver failure, oxidative stress (damage to skin, muscle and tendon tissue, etc.), poor absorption of zinc and copper and inadequate immunity. Pastures on acid and clay soils, as well as the forage produced from them, should be monitored (risk of high iron levels), especially if your horse shows any of the above signs. If your horse is being treated for anaemia, peppermint should be given at a different time of day.
Composition
Organic Peppermint - Mentha piperita
Aerial parts.
Dosage
Up to 10g / day per 100kg
i.e. 50g / day for a horse weighing 500kg.
The dosage should be adjusted according to the effectiveness observed.
